Mangalore Airport Information

Mangalore
One of the most important port cities in India, Mangalore is beautifully flanked by the expansive Arabian Sea on one side and the mighty Western Ghats on the other. The beauty of the city is greatly enhanced by the backwaters of the Netravati and Gurupura Rivers. Blessed with a tropical climate, this city can be visited at any time and any season of the year. There are literally so many things to do in Mangalore that tourists will surely get spoilt for choices. They can go for beach hopping in one of the many gorgeous beaches like Someshwar Beach, Panambur Beach, Surathkal Beach and Kapu Beach or pay a visit to the Pilikula Nisarga Dhama - an entertainment hub that features a golf course, science centre, arboretum, animal park and an exciting water theme park. They can also explore the dense forests of the Western Ghats. Mangalore also has many places of religious importance that draw a number of pilgrims from near and far. Worth-mentioning among them are the Mangaladevi Temple, Shree Shanaishchara Temple, Carstreet Venkataramana Temple, St. Aloysius Chapel and Ullal Darga. About Sydney (SYD)

Sydney is famous as the Harbour city and the most amazing cosmopolitan city in Australia. With an excellent reputation as one of the world's most amazing and liveable cities, Sydney becomes a most famous tourist destination. Stuffed with lots of ancient history, nature, culture, art, fashion, cuisine, design that makes Sydney an attractive tourist spot which is set next to miles of ocean coastline and numerous sandy surf beaches. It is counted among the most culturally and ethnically diverse cities in Australia. Sydney is also considered as a dwell to the Sydney Opera House and the Sydney Harbour Bridge. These two are the most iconic structures on the planet. It is a high ranking world-class city which has till date hosted multiple number of major international sporting events. Some of the major tourist destinations in Sydney include The Sydney Harbour Bridge, The Sydney Opera House, Sydney Olympic Park, Royal Botanic Garden, St Mary's Cathedral, Chinese Garden of Friendship, Sydney Park, Hyde Park, The Domain and the Royal Botanic Gardens, Australian Museum (natural history and anthropology), the Powerhouse Museum (science, technology and design), the Art Gallery of New South Wales, the Museum of Contemporary Art, the Australian National Maritime Museum and many others which altogether makes Sydney a wonderful place to visit at least once. It is also famous for its wildlife as here you can find Koala Park Sanctuary number of zoo and other wildlife parks such as Taronga Zoo, Koala Park Sanctuary, Sydney Aquarium, Sydney Wildlife World, Featherdale Wildlife Park, Australian Reptile Park and so on.
